Datalogics announces the release of the new Bookvia™ for Android reading application

(PR NewsChannel) / January 26, 2017 / CHICAGO 

DatalogicsDatalogics, the premier source for PDF and eBook technologies, announces the release of Bookvia™ for sonydadc_logo_Android, a new mobile reading solution integrated with Sony DADC’s User Rights Management Solution.

Bookvia, an eReader app, designed to support major DRM systems, available on both Android and iOS allows users to consolidate their electronic publications in one application. Bookvia offers users a powerful and engaging reading experience, and enables stores to streamline content delivery to the reader through a common bookshelf.

About Sony DADC

Sony DADC is a leading disc and digital solution provider for the entertainment, education and information industries, offering world-class optical media replication services, digital and physical supply chain solutions and software services. The company’s network consists of service offices, optical media production, distribution and digital facilities around the globe. The URMS technology is created by Denuvo Software Solutions, the team that developed best-of-breed copy protection systems like Denuvo Anti Tamper for games and Screen Pass for movies.

About Datalogics

Chicago-based Datalogics, Incorporated, the premier source for PDF and eBook technologies, has dedicated over 45 years to delivering the highest quality software.  Datalogics offers solutions that include a wide range of powerful PDF and eBook technologies for .NET, Java, and C/C++ developers. Datalogics is a member of the International Digital Publishing Forum (IDPF) and the Readium Foundation, and is on the board of the PDF Association.
